Table 1

Manifestations of gastrointestinal tract involvement in systemic sclerosis.

Anatomical regionManifestation

OesophagusDysmotility
Reflux oesophagitis
Gastroesophageal reflux disease
Stricture Barrett’s oesophagus, adenocarcinoma (advanced)

StomachGastritis and gastric ulcers
Gastroparesis
Gastric antral vascular ectasia (GAVE)

Small intestineHypomotility
Pseudoobstruction
Jejunal diverticuli
Small intestine bacterial overgrowth (SIBO)
Pneumatosis cystoides intestinalis (PCI)

ColonHypomotility
Wide mouthed diverticuli
Chronic intestinal pseudoobstruction (CIPO)
Megacolon

AnorectumFecal incontinence
